Crime overview

Briar Avenue area has the 12th lowest crime rate of 44 local areas in Norbury & Pollards Hill , and the 247th lowest crime rate of 1,082 local areas in Croydon .

This postcode forms a relatively safe pocket compared with the surrounding streets. Neighbouring areas record much higher crime levels, even though this postcode itself remains comparatively low-crime.

The overall crime rate in the area around Briar Avenue (SW16 3AA) in the last 12 months was 38.4 per 1,000 residents and was 68.9% lower than the Norbury & Pollards Hill average (123.5 per 1,000 residents). In the last 12 months, this area’s most reported crimes were Vehicle crime with 4 offences recorded. The least common crime was Criminal damage and arson with 1 case , up 100.0% compared to 2024. The fastest-growing crime category was Robbery ( 200.0% YoY). The sharpest decline was Violence and sexual offences ( -85.7% YoY).

Violent crimes totalled 5 (≈ 12.0 per 1,000 residents). Year-over-year these were falling ( -68.8% ). Over the last decade, overall crime has rising ( 405.3% comparing early vs recent averages) .

In the area around Briar Avenue (SW16 3AA), the highest concentration of overall crime is near St Leonard'S Walk, where police recorded 34 incidents. Violent and public-order offences occur most often near Granville Gardens (12 offences). Both locations lie within roughly 0.3 miles of this postcode area.
